tavern burger is outstanding. we had lunch today for the firsttimeat tavern but it sure won't be the last!
the tavern burger is outstanding! made of beef ribeye and filet, the burger was juicy and the taste of high end beef. the plate was served with very fresh lettuce, fresh tomatoes, sliced tomatores and a "meltaway" bun which we believe means that it had butter on it as it was delicious! in addition, the burger came with a huge bowl of belgium fries (sea salt & garlic).
my friend had the mahi burger which was also served on a meltaway bun and very good. somehow he received different chips and when our server recognized it, she gave us even more chips. the sweet potato chips were some of the best i've ever had!
although the restaurant is loud during the lunch hour, by 1:30 we were able to converse at normal level.

great place. when tavern first opened, i honestly tried not to like it. i had low expectations before i dined here my firsttimeand thought that it was going to be another trendy, over-priced, mediocre dining experience. i was wrong. i've been for dinner, lunch, and multiple times for brunch (this is one my favorite brunch spots...i'll elaborate more in this in a minute). the sweet potato chips with the warm blue cheese fondue is an awesome app. i've heard the "chicken skins" are awesome too, but i can't bring myself to try those. the nachos are huge and enough to share with a table of ten. the junk salad is my absolute favorite salad in nashville. it has everything that i love in it: crispy lettuce, shrimp, pepperoncinis, tomato, cucumber, etc. my husband loves the burger and i am so interested in the chicken and waffles, which again i can't bring myself to order. all of the tacos are ahhhmazing and fresh. but, my favorite part about tavern is their brunch on saturday and sunday. i love going here in the summer for brunch, but especially in the winter too. 2 for 1 brunch liberations=great deal+great drinks. where to start with the brunch menu-my favorites are: benedict dos (with smoked salmon), huevos rancheros, and the singapore stir fry (which is again, my husband's favorite). also, if you need a side to choose, do not skip the white trash hash...you'll love it.

great place to be with friends. i love bringing my out of town guests here on early saturday afternoons to have a great brunch and start to the weekend!
